For a three phase full controlled converter, with 3 thyristors in the upper or positive group and 3 thyristors in the lower or negative group, at any given timea)two thyristors are conducting from each groupb)one thyristor is conducting from each groupc)one thyristor is conducting from either of the groupsd)all 6 thyristors are conducting at a timeCorrect answer is option 'B'.
